Late last month, Kaiser Permanente acknowledged it had potentially leaked the personal data of millions of customers to tech giants Microsoft, Google and social-media platform X.There’s still not a lot known about the incident; Kaiser representatives have offered little additional information. But here’s what we know so far.Up to 13.4 million. That number includes patients and current and former members, according to a statement from the organization.
It’s unclear whether Kaiser officials were aware of the lawsuit or when they became aware of it. The organization was not named in the lawsuit. Alex Baehr, a partner with Summit Law Group, which represents the plaintiff, declined to discuss the case and why Kaiser wasn’t named in it.That’s also not clear. In a statement about the leak, Kaiser said only that it was “not aware of any misuse of any member’s or patient’s personal information.
